Scheduling issues forced Gordon State and ABAC to play back to back games over the week with the Highlanders picking up two wins, Thursday's 8-2 home victory followed by Saturday's 4-0 win on the road. 
 
The Highlanders maintained possession of the game with ABAC reverting to their deep line defending abandoning the high press which saw them give up eight goals the previous game. Gordon State would open the scoring on a nice switch of play which saw Skylar Bertram send Courtney Hahn in behind the ABAC defensive line for the first goal of the game in the 31st minute. Bertram followed her assist with a goal of her own 10 minutes later assisted by Beatriz Ramos which sent the Highlanders into halftime with a 2-0 lead.
 
          
 
The Lady Highlanders put the game away with two back to back goals in the second half, both scored in the 56th minute of the game. Demi Kiker scored to put the Highlanders up 3-0 with another assist by Bertram followed by the final goal of the game made by Kaitlin O'Connor and assisted by Jordan White.
 
The Highlander defense had another impressive game, not allowing a shot in goal, and goalkeeper Brooke Shavers used her feet more than her hands as she played as a deep support role in the Highlanders possession play.
